Middle Finger Making Comeback in Washington

middle_finger_monkey-12508.jpgCBS award-winning White House Correspondent Mark Knoller cracking wise about President Obama’s intolerance toward “finger pointing.”

Knoller tweeted, “Always finger-pointing in Washington. Especially middle-finger pointing. That’s why “speak on condition of anonymity.”
Knoller was commenting on what President Obama reportedly said in the Situation Room Tuesday regarding Flight 253.

“We were told Obama said, ‘While there will be a tendency for finger pointing, I will not tolerate it,’” the scribe explained. “And some of my Twitter followers asked about finger-pointing in Washington and that prompted my wiseguy response.”

Note: The accompanying photograph, appropriately called the “middle finger monkey,” was not provided by Knoller.
